titleOfInvention Method and device for positioning target in vehicle-road cooperation, electronic equipment and medium
abstract The present disclosure provides a method of target localization, comprising: acquiring a two-dimensional image by an image acquisition unit with a known position; analyzing the two-dimensional image to determine the target to be positioned therein, and the size and morphology of the target; determining a pixel point of a target in the two-dimensional image, which corresponds to the ground, as a calibration point, and determining the position of the calibration point relative to the target according to the size and the form of the target; mapping ground points in a preset map point cloud to a two-dimensional image to determine the ground points corresponding to at least part of pixel points; determining the position of the ground point relative to the image acquisition unit according to the position of the image acquisition unit, and determining the position of the calibration point relative to the image acquisition unit; and determining the position of the target relative to the image acquisition unit according to the position of the calibration point relative to the image acquisition unit and the position of the calibration point relative to the target. The disclosure also provides a target positioning device, an electronic device and a computer readable medium.
